Composition / Information on Ingredients
Chemical components, concentration ranges, and hazardous substance identification
| Chemical Name | CAS Number | Concentration | Hazardous |
|---|---|---|---|
| Cyclohexanone EC: 203-631-1 | 108-94-1 | 20 - 40% | Yes |
| Titanium dioxide EC: 236-675-5 | 13463-67-7 | 50% | Yes |
| pentan-2-one EC: 203-528-1 | 107-87-9 | 5 - 35% | Yes |
| aluminium powder (stabilised) EC: 231-072-3 | 7429-90-5 | 10% | Yes |
| Zinc (pyrophoric) EC: 231-175-3 | 7440-66-6 | 5% | Yes |
| Carbon black EC: 215-609-9 | 1333-86-4 | 5% | Yes |
| 4-[[4-(aminocarbonyl)phenyl]azo]-N-(2-ethoxyphenyl)-3-hydroxynaphthalene-2-carboxamide, C.I. Pigment Red 170 EC: 220-509-3 | 2786-76-7 | 5% | Yes |
| Aluminum hydroxide EC: 244-492-7 | 21645-51-2 | 5% | No |
| Ethyl acetate EC: 205-500-4 | 141-78-6 | 0.1 - 2% | Yes |
| 2-methoxy-1-methylethyl acetate EC: 203-603-9 | 108-65-6 | 1% | Yes |
| Aluminum oxide EC: 215-691-6 | 1344-28-1 | 1% | No |
| [N,N,N',N',N''-N''-hexAethyl-29H,31H-phthalocyaninetrimethylaminato(2-)-N29,N30,N31,N32]copper EC: 249-125-4 | 28654-73-1 | 0.2% | Yes |
| Toluene EC: 203-625-9 | 108-88-3 | 0.2% | Yes |
| barium sulfate EC: 231-784-4 | 7727-43-7 | 0.2% | No |
| aluminium powder (pyrophoric) EC: 231-072-3 | 7429-90-5 | 0.2% | Yes |
| Butyl acetate EC: 204-658-1 | 123-86-4 | 0.1% | Yes |
| 2-methoxypropyl acetate EC: 274-724-2 | 70657-70-4 | 0.1% | Yes |
First Aid Measures
Emergency procedures for chemical exposure incidents
If inhaled and if breathing is difficult, remove victim to fresh air and keep at rest in a position comfortable for breathing.
Symptoms: In high concentrations : Harmful if inhaled. Inhalation may cause: irritation, coughing, shortness of breath.
Rinse skin with water/shower. Remove/Take off immediately all contaminated clothing.
If in eyes: Rinse cautiously with water for several minutes. Remove contact lenses, if present and easy to do. Continue rinsing.
Symptoms: Direct contact with the eyes is likely to be irritating.
Rinse mouth. Call a POISON CENTER or doctor/physician if you feel unwell.
Symptoms: Swallowing a small quantity of this material will result in serious health hazard.
Immediate Medical Attention
IF exposed or concerned: Get medical advice/attention.
Medical Treatment
All treatments should be based on observed signs and symptoms of distress in the patient.
Firefighting Measures
Extinguishing media, specific hazards, and firefighter protection
Use extinguishing media appropriate for surrounding fire.
None known.
Highly flammable liquid and vapour. Product is not explosive. No dangerous reactions known.
Exercise caution when fighting any chemical fire. Do not allow run-off from fire fighting to enter drains or water courses.
Firefighter Protection
Do not enter fire area without proper protective equipment, including respiratory protection. Wear fire/flame resistant/retardant clothing. Wear a self contained breathing apparatus. EN469.

Handling and Storage
Safe handling precautions, storage conditions, and workplace requirements
No open flames. No smoking. Use only non-sparking tools. Use only outdoors or in a well-ventilated area. Avoid breathing vapour/mist. Avoid contact with skin and eyes.
Keep container tightly closed. Keep away from open flames, hot surfaces and sources of ignition.
Do not eat, drink or smoke when using this product. Wash hands and other exposed areas with mild soap and water before eating, drinking or smoking and when leaving work.
Keep away from heat, sparks and flame.
Exposure Controls / PPE
Occupational exposure limits, engineering controls, and protective equipment
Provide local exhaust ventilation of closed transfer systems to minimize exposures.
None under normal use. It is a good industrial hygiene practice to minimize skin contact. Wear suitable gloves. rubber. EN 374.
No special eye protection equipment recommended under normal conditions of use. Eye protection should only be necessary where liquid could be splashed or sprayed. EN 166.
No special respiratory protection equipment is recommended under normal conditions of use with adequate ventilation. In case of inadequate ventilation wear respiratory protection. Use an approved respirator equipped with oil/mist cartridges. EN 12083.

Stability and Reactivity
Chemical stability, hazardous reactions, and incompatible materials
Highly flammable liquid and vapour.
No dangerous reactions known.
Hazardous polymerization will not occur.
Keep away from sources of ignition.
Oxidizing agent. Moisture. Alkali. acid.
Thermal decomposition generates : metallic oxides. Carbon monoxide. Carbon dioxide.
